Patricia Hewitt MP announced on Tuesday that she would not be standing again for re-election in Leicester West at the next General Election.
She said: “This has been a very difficult decision to make, but after talking it through with my family I have decided that by the next election this will be the right thing to do for me and my family.”
Ms Hewitt also said that she wants to spend more time on work and charitable activities related to India. Next month she takes over as chair of the UK India Business Council and is also involved in the Delhi based charity, Katha.
Ms Hewitt stressed that she will continue to help and make representations on behalf of her constituents in Leicester West until the General Election, when she will ceas being a Member of Parliament.
